CORE ALF EXAM QUESTIONS WITH
COMPLETE ANSWERS
The facility, Upon resident request, may provide for the safekeeping in the facility of up
to: - Answer-$500 in personal funds and $500 in personal property

If the resident is expected to be absent for more than 24 hr, the facility may provide for
safekeeping of more than $500 in personal property - Answer-True

How often must the facility provide a statement detailing the income and expense
records of resident - Answer-Quarterly

If The owner, administrator serves as resident's payee the resident shall be given, on a
annual basis a written statement of any transaction made on behalf of the resident -
Answer-False: statement must be provided monthly

New Hired staff shall have how many days to submit a statement that the person does
not have any signs or symptoms of communicable disease including TB - Answer-30
days after employment

How much time do you have to submit incident report to AHCA? - Answer-1 business
day for 1 day reports and 15 calendar days for the 15 day Full report

You should always place a copy of the incident report in the residents medical records -
Answer-False: you should keep them but it doesn't have to be in the residents file.

Staff who provide direct care to residents, other than nurses, CNA, Home health aides
must receive a minimum of 1hr in service training in infection control, universal
precaution sanitation before providing care - Answer-True

What is the continuing education requirements for the admin and ECC supervisior?
4hr? or 2hrs? minimum every two years of physical, psychological or social needs of
frail elderly and disabled persons or person with Alzheimers disease - Answer-4hrs

The administrator, manager and staff, who have direct contact with mental health
residents in a licensed LMH must receive 3hrs? 4hrs? 6hrs? minimum of continuing
education.. - Answer-3hrs

How often must facilities have elopement drills? - Answer-a minimum of two resident
elopement prevention and response drills per year

Successful completion of the assisted living facility core training is not a prerequisite for
the initial 4 hour ECC training - Answer-False

, All Direct care staff in a ECC must complete at least 2hrs? or 4hrs?of in service training,
provided by the admin or ECC supervisor, within 6 months? or 30 days? of employment
- Answer-2hrs within 6 months

Staff who have regular contact or direct care for resident with ADRD shall obtain 2 hrs
of initial training with in 3 months of employment - Answer-False: 4 hrs of initial training

Any new facility with 8 beds must be equipped with an automatic fire sprinkler system -
Answer-True

How many years must you keep a record of major incident? - Answer-2 years

A grievance procedure for receiving and responding to resident complaints and
recommendations should be filed in residents or facility records? - Answer-Facility
records

All completed surveys, inspection and complaint investigation reports, and notices of
sanctions and moratoriums issued by the agency must be kept for how many years? -
Answer-5

A copy of the job description given to each staff member for 16 or more residents
should be filed in staff records - Answer-False

ECC facilities records need to include the doctor progress notes for each resident
receiving nursing services - Answer-False: nurse assessments, policies and
procedures, service plans for each resident receiving ECC services

A resident being discharged from the facility must receive a least 30 days? 45 days? or
60 days? notice of relocation or termination. - Answer-45 days
